CMA clears ZPG’s aquisition of Expert Agent.

ZPG announced Thursday, June 29, 2017,  that the Competition and Markets Authority (CMA) has  cleared its acquisition of Expert Agent.

ZPG acquired Expert Agent in March as part of its continuing mission to be the most effective partner for UK property professionals.

With the CMA review complete and the transaction having received the green light, ZPG is now able to progress with its integration plans for the business, although it indicated at the time of its acquisition that it intends to continue to operate Expert Agent as a standalone brand and platform.

Mark Goddard, Managing Director of ZPG’s Property division commented,

“We are delighted but not surprised by the outcome of this review by the CMA. We always felt that the UK property software sector is well-served by numerous players who offer strong, effective competition and are pleased that the CMA has come to the same conclusion. With this matter now concluded, we will be progressing our plans to integrate Expert Agent into the wider ZPG business and to deliver the related benefits for our partners.”
